Technical Specifications
- Camera Resolution: 720P HD
- Cable Length: 200FT
- Sonde Frequency: 512Hz
- Monitor Size: 7 inches
- Battery Life: Up to 6 hours

Performance and Usage Table
| Feature | PRANITE Sewer Camera | RIDGID SeeSnake | Gemway Wireless Camera |
|---|---|---|---|
| Camera Resolution | 720P HD | 720P HD | 1080P HD |
| Cable Length | 200FT | 100FT | 50FT |
| Sonde Frequency | 512Hz | 512Hz | N/A |
| Monitor Size | 7 inches | 5 inches | 5 inches |
| Price | $299 | $499 | $239 |
